Job Description:
The Quality Technician will be responsible for inspecting GMPs, ensuring product quality, and identifying anything that might pose a food safety risk.
There are 4 tiers of training/pay levels and once this person clears a level of training, they will have mastered certain skills.
This person will be moving from one production line to the next 50% of the time and the other 50% of the time they will be at the computer labeling proofs, making COAs, and putting compliance products on hold.
They will be filling out a daily checklist and answering questions that the rest of the production team comes to them with.
This person will be heavily communicating with the Production Supervisors.
Overview of training levels Bronze Level
Observe and report
Work practices of production and other employees
Proper GMP's are being followed
Inspect in-process and finished products for quality and compliance to specifications
Perform other tasks and projects on an as needed basis
Silver Level
Adhere to the guidelines in the label compliance policy
Log and report quality holds to the rest of the organization
Review incoming COA's for compliance to specifications
Perform product testing on residual O2
Manage retain products
Complete pre-shipment reviews as needed
Gold Level
Perform equipment calibrations
Maintain product attributes library
Perform security and storage verifications
Sample prep for external laboratories
Assist with training within the department
Platinum Level
Assist with environmental swabbing
Compose, analyze, and provide customers with COA's
Perform a series of additional audits and inspections
Assist with ensuring product specifications are current and accurate
